Fruit and Vegetable Juice Concentrate improves Skin

An Encapsulated Fruit and Vegetable Juice Concentrate Increases Skin Microcirculation in Healthy Woman

Conclusion: Ingestion of a fruit- and vegetable-based concentrate increases microcirculation of the skin at 12 weeks of intervention and positively affects skin hydration, density and thickness.

Natural Choices for Fibromyalgia

I recommend "Natural Choices for Fibromyalgia," by Jane Oelke, N.D., Ph.D.!

From the Book, "Natural Choices for Fibromyalgia", by Jone Oelke, N.D., Ph.D.
presents practical suggestions for relief of pain based on the results of a research study of metabolism. Using the results from this bio-chemical study of a variety of urine and saliva tests, people with Fibromyalgia will realize the possible causes of their pain. Then overviews of nutrition, homeopathy, and stress reduction techniques, that are commonly used to reduce pain, are presented. Some of the topics covered include:


  • the cause of hypersensitivity to pain
  • adrenal stress and fatigue
  • environmental stress and acidity
  • ways to monitor health with bio-chemical testing
  • associated conditions to Fibromyalgia
  • the role of antioxidants for the immune system
  • minerals needed for cell nutrition
  • essential fatty acids for relief of stiffness
  • enzymes for energy
  • bodywork techniques for stress reduction.


Jane Oelke, N.D., Ph.D., is a Naturopathic Doctor who helps clients improve their health naturally. She has taught seminars to the medical community on Fibromyalgia, and has worked with clients who have been diagnosed with Fibromyalgia. Her background in Mechanical Engineering has led her to do various research projects in the natural health field. This book is a result of the compilation of information from seminars and the bio-chemical urine and saliva testing research study results with people who have Fibromyalgia.
